
如何制作Linux U盘启动系统-打造高效移动操作系统
下载需积分: 49 | 4KB |
更新于2025-04-29
| 45 浏览量 | 举报
1
收藏
由于提供的文件信息较为简单,仅包含标题、描述、标签和一个压缩文件的名称,而没有具体的文档内容,因此无法生成直接针对文档内容的知识点。不过,根据标题和描述,可以推断文档可能涉及的IT知识点,并围绕“把Linux装进U盘”和“打造简洁移动系统”这两个主题进行扩展。
### Linux操作系统
Linux是一种自由和开放源代码的类Unix操作系统,主要通过在互联网上由世界各地的志愿者开发而成。它以其稳定、高效、灵活等特性受到广泛欢迎,被应用在服务器、嵌入式系统、桌面计算机等多个领域。Linux内核(Kernel)是其核心部分,管理着计算机的硬件资源,同时提供程序运行的环境。
### U盘(USB闪存驱动器)
U盘是一种使用USB接口的小型便携式存储设备,用于数据的存储和传输。在本文档中,U盘将会被用作安装Linux系统,使其成为一个移动式的操作系统载体。
### 制作Linux启动U盘
将Linux操作系统安装到U盘,实际上是将Linux系统的安装镜像写入U盘,使其成为一个可引导设备。以下是大致步骤:
1. 准备一个容量足够的U盘(建议至少8GB)。
2. 下载一个Linux发行版的ISO镜像文件。
3. 使用特定的工具(如Rufus、Etcher等)将ISO文件写入U盘。
4. 设置计算机BIOS或UEFI,从U盘启动。
### 移动系统的特点
“移动系统”通常指的是操作系统安装在便携式设备上,可以随身携带,从而实现随时随地的系统使用。这种系统的特点包括:
- 独立性:不需要依赖特定的计算机硬件。
- 便携性:体积小,方便携带。
- 简洁性:根据需要定制操作系统,去除不必要的组件和服务。
- 启动快速:通常U盘系统的启动速度会非常快。
### 打造简洁移动系统的策略
打造简洁的移动系统,需要对Linux系统进行优化和定制。以下是可能涉及的知识点:
1. **选择合适的Linux发行版**:某些发行版如Lubuntu、Puppy Linux等以轻量级和快速启动为特点。
2. **最小化安装**:仅安装系统的基础包和必要的软件。
3. **使用Live CD环境**:创建一个可完全运行在内存中的系统环境,避免对U盘的频繁读写。
4. **定制内核**:优化和裁剪内核,只包含必要的驱动和模块。
5. **自启动程序管理**:通过系统服务管理工具来管理启动项,确保快速启动。
6. **文件系统选择和优化**:使用如XFS、Btrfs等现代文件系统,进行性能优化和日志记录调整。
7. **界面简洁化**:选择或定制轻量级桌面环境,并去除不必要的视觉特效。
8. **数据保护**:设置U盘为只读模式,或采用可写的镜像文件,减少系统文件损坏的可能性。
### 使用场景
简洁移动系统可以广泛应用于多种场景,如:
- 网络维护:利用Linux系统强大的网络工具进行故障排查和维护。
- 数据恢复:使用Linux的文件系统工具对无法启动的系统进行数据恢复。
- 现场演示:携带Linux系统的U盘可以随时在任何支持的计算机上进行演示。
- 紧急修复:为无法启动的计算机提供一个临时的操作环境,进行必要的修复工作。
### 结语
通过对Linux系统的精心定制和优化,能够打造出一个体积小、启动快、便携且功能集中的移动系统,极大地提高工作的灵活性和效率。这份文档可能将指导用户如何实现这样的系统,而具体实现过程将需要详细的步骤指导、软件工具的介绍、系统配置的最佳实践等。
相关推荐









baidu_33985279
- 粉丝: 0
最新资源
- GCC与GFortran命令手册解析
- 超文本批处理神器:文档替换工具使用详解
- 学生信息管理系统的设计与实现
- USB接口动态连接库的实现与应用
- JavaScript网页特效经典实例150个(附源码)
- 微软推出asp.net树形菜单控件中文版
- C++面试考点全面解析:题集大梳理
- Ibatis框架在PetShop中的应用研究
- UML面向对象建模入门教程:三日速成指南
- 2010年JAVA笔试题最新汇总及答案解析
- OpenGL的GLUT库3.7.6版本文件解析
- VRML全景技术:代码实例详解与全景展示
- C#实现SQL数据库备份并通过FTP上载教程
- 移动硬盘数据恢复与强力格式化解决方案
- 使用VBS脚本实现软件卸载的简易方法
- 最新版WIN2003系统下IIS6缺少文件解决方案
- 用户注册功能的Struts2.0、Hibernate3和Spring2.0部署指南
- ajaxTree:实现无刷新树形控件的下载与示例
- Java线程编程:深入理解生产者与消费者模式
- 演示如何在Delphi标题栏上添加按钮
- C#编写的蜘蛛采集程序源代码分析
- Java开发常用库文件压缩包上传指南
- 全新网吧主动防御系统解决方案-夏软金盾4.1发布
- C++编程100例题及源代码大公开